About The Position

The Case Managers are experienced Registered Nurses who interact with the patient, families, physicians and other members of the interdisciplinary team to facilitate quality and cost effective care. An essential component to all roles includes the evaluation of medical necessity and intensity of service of each admission to arrive at decisions regarding medical appropriateness for the requested level of care. Communicates with the various payers/insurance companies to authorize services and ensure appropriate reimbursement to the facility. Actively promotes collaboration among all interdisciplinary care providers, including physicians to effectively identify needs for continued inpatient care or appropriate alternate levels of care. There is coordination to affect an appropriate discharge plan with the Case Managers ensuring arrangements of placement/services upon discharge. Assist to identify and make efforts to correct delays in services, fragmentation of care and gaps in communication. Patient outcome monitoring and participation in continuous performance improvement are also requirements in this role.
